jinlin
2024-07-30 481b82866b1714f79dc35ecf2bc26436b027954e
web/src/views/modules/taskReliability/SimulatHistory.vue
@@ -13,11 +13,11 @@
            <zt-select v-model="dataForm.id" :datas="simulatList" @change="onSimulatSelected"/>
          </zt-form-item>
          <zt-form-item label="采样周期" prop="samplPeriod">
            <el-input v-model="dataForm.samplPeriod" >
            <el-input v-model="dataForm.samplPeriod" readonly="false">
            </el-input>
          </zt-form-item>
          <zt-form-item label="仿真总时长" prop="taskDuration">
            <el-input v-model="dataForm.taskDuration" >
          <zt-form-item label="仿真次数" prop="simulatFrequency">
            <el-input v-model="dataForm.simulatFrequency" readonly="false" >
            </el-input>
          </zt-form-item>
        </el-form>
@@ -25,7 +25,7 @@
          <el-col :span="4">
            <div style="margin-right: 5px;height: calc(88vh - 100px)" v-if="isSelect">
              <product-model-tree @on-selected="onTreeSelected" showXdy="false"
                                  ref="ProductModelTree" :isShow="false"/>
                                  ref="ProductModelTree" :isShow="false" basic="4"/>
            </div>
          </el-col>
          <el-col :span="20">
@@ -43,7 +43,6 @@
<script>
  import SimulatCurve from "./SimulatCurve";
  import SimulatData from "./SimulatData";
  import ProductModelTree from "../basicInfo/ProductModelTree";
@@ -56,8 +55,6 @@
        productList: [],
        simulatList: [],
        taskList: [],
        MTBF: '',
        MTTR: '',
        dataForm: {
          id: '',
          taskDuration:'',
@@ -78,7 +75,6 @@
    components: {
      ProductModelTree,
      SimulatCurve,
      SimulatData
    },
    methods: {
@@ -104,9 +100,11 @@
        this.simulatList = res.data
      },
      onTreeSelected(data) {
        if (this.dataForm.id){
        console.log(data, 'onProductSelected')
        this.dataForm.showProductId = data.id
        this.$refs.SimulatCurve.getProductEcharts(this.dataForm);
        }
      },
      // 获取信息
      onProductSelected(data) {
@@ -134,8 +132,9 @@
          taskModelId: this.dataForm.taskModelId
        }
        let res = await this.$http.get('/taskReliability/SimulatAssess/getSimulatParams', {params: params})
        console.log(res.data.samplPeriod)
        this.dataForm.taskDuration = res.data.taskDuration
        this.dataForm.samplPeriod = res.data.samplPeriod
        this.dataForm.simulatFrequency = res.data.simulatFrequency
      }
    }
  }